California Powder Works Bridge
Bridge
Photo: KLOTZ, CC BY-SA 3.0.
The California Powder Works Bridge is a historic covered bridge in Santa Cruz, California. It is a Smith truss bridge, built across the San Lorenzo River in 1872 by the California Powder Works, an explosives manufacturer whose factory complex stood on the river banks. California Powder Works Bridge is situated 4,000 feet south of Powder Mill Fire Road Trail.
Roaring Camp & Big Trees Narrow Gauge Railroad
Park
Photo: Josh Hallett, CC BY-SA 2.0.
The Roaring Camp & Big Trees Narrow Gauge Railroad is a 3 ft narrow-gauge tourist railroad in California that starts from the Roaring Camp depot in Felton, California and runs up steep grades through redwood forests to the top of nearby Bear Mountain, a distance of 3.25 miles. Roaring Camp & Big Trees Narrow Gauge Railroad is situated 1½ miles northwest of Powder Mill Fire Road Trail.
